The initiative of Ninib A. Lahdo – 6750-2000 years – is a testimony of all
this where Mousa Elias, talented composer and ud-player, has managed to
create new melodies, maintaining the principles of the Syriac national
music. The new musical language where for the first time a big orchestra is
being used to perform Syriac music using forms of classical orchestration
(harmonic and polyphonic) in the music where we usually meet ¼ notes (non-temperated).
Surely, this is due to cooperation with the Armenian composer and singer
Arsen Grigorian.
